Five Habits of Wildly Unsuccessful CIOs
Jason Hiner of TechRepublic in his video blog presents five key habits of unsucessful CIOs. According to Hiner, these CIOs are short sighted, have inflated egos, and have no business sense. They do the following:
- Acquire technology because it is new
- Do not consider open-source solutions
- Build an in-house solution when there is an out-of-the box solution
- Do not understand the relationship between IT and business
- Communitcate poorly with other executives in the organizations
